My only complaint is that the waterproof lining does not breathe well with the full leather upper. I love the style and construction, but would rather a gortex liner or venting. I would sacrifice waterproof for breathability with these. I wear them everyday for work and they hold up phenomenally well. Use them as a dedicated hiker, work shoe for on roofs and ladders, or casual everyday walking. After a year of regular use, the outside has held up, but my feet get swampy rather fast. Cleaning and swapping insoles is no longer doing the trick. This is my 3rd pair maybe? Time for a new pair of something... maybe the Grandview GTX low.

Well, this is my second pair, but there was a subtle change from the previous one which I like less. Eyelets for the laces instead of the leather guides. The shoes don't stay tied either (back to the laces and guides I expect), so I have to double knot them, whereas the old ones never had that problem.
